Use of the built-in theme store
The easiest and safest way to change the look of text is to use the Themes app preinstalled, which has hundreds of design options, many of which include modified system fonts. To get started, open the Themes app on the home screen or in the Tools folder.
At the bottom of the screen, look for the Profile tab (usually marked with a person icon) and select Fonts. This shows a list of options available for download. Some are free, others require payment or viewing ads. After selecting the option you like, click Download and then Apply.
β οΈ Note: Some fonts in the catalog may not contain a complete set of Cyrillic characters. Before using, be sure to check the preview in Russian to avoid the appearance of "squares" instead of letters.
It takes only a few seconds to apply, and then the system automatically restarts the interface, and if you don't like the result, you can always go back to standard design through the same settings section, which makes the design experiments completely safe for the device.
Setting the size and style of text in the system
If your goal is not so much design as readability, then standard settings are the best. MIUI They offer great tools. Go to the Settings menu. β Screen. β Text and display. You can adjust the font size without installing third-party files.
Five size gradations are available in this section, from the smallest to the very largest, and the changes are applied instantly to the entire interface, including messages, browsers and system menus, especially for visually impaired users or those who prefer large typography.
- π Slider adjustment allows you to find the perfect balance between the amount of information on the screen and readability.
- ποΈ Large text mode not only increases letters, but also some interface elements for better perception.
- π¨ Separately, you can adjust the boldness of the mark, if such an option is supported by the current theme of design.
It is worth noting that resizing the system font does not affect the zoom of images or videos, it is only a textual setting that helps to adapt the smartphone to the individual needs of the owner of the Redmi Note 10.

Manual installation of third-party fonts
For advanced users who do not have a standard set, it is possible to manually install files in.ttf or.otf formats. This method requires downloading a file from a reliable source and placing it in a specific memory directory of the device.
First, you need to download the font file. Then, using a file manager (like Explorer or MIUI File Manager), create a folder called fonts at the root of the internal memory. Place the downloaded file in this folder. After the device is restarted, the system can suggest using a new font.

However, newer versions of MIUI may block direct installation through the folder by security, requiring the use of dedicated installer applications or the application of methods through ADB. Be careful: installing a corrupted file may cause incorrect text display throughout the system.

Using applications to change font
If the built-in tools don't work, Google Play apps come to the rescue, programs like zFont 3 or Font Fix automate the installation process, scan the system, determine the version of MIUI, and suggest a suitable method for implementing the font.
These utilities usually work on temporarily replacing system files or creating a local profile. Once you run the application, select the desired font from the built-in library or download your file. The program will perform the necessary actions, including creating a backup.
- π² zFont 3 is a popular solution that supports many brands, including Xiaomi.
- π οΈ Font Fix β allows you to use fonts even on devices without root rights, using special activation methods.
- π iFont is another powerful tool with a large font base and the ability to preview.
When using third-party software, it is important to carefully monitor the permissions requested. Some applications may request access to the file system, which is necessary to replace the system font files.

Return to standard font and eliminate errors
Sometimes, after experimenting with typography, the system may not work smoothly, or the new font will simply stop liking it. It's very easy to go back to the original state. Go to the Topics app, go to profile, and select the Fonts section.
In the list of installed fonts, find an option called "Default", "Classic" or "Standard". Click on it and select "Apply" button. The system will return the original Roboto font or the one used by default in the factory.
If the interface is no longer displayed correctly (artifacts appear, text is missing from the menu), try a soft reboot. Press the power button 10-15 seconds before vibration. If the problem persists, the font configuration file may have been damaged, and you will need to reset through the Recovery menu.
β οΈ Warning: If after installing the font, the phone goes into a cyclic restart (bootloop), do not panic. Try to boot into safe mode by pressing the volume button when turned on, and delete the problem file through the explorer.
